What You Should Know About The Bariatric Surgery New York Doctors Perform

By Rebecca Brooks


If losing weight has been an ongoing battle and you are now at a dangerously unhealthy weight, surgery could be the right solution for you. Surgical treatments have helped countless people experience ultra-fast weight loss. These procedures are often essential for those who have lost mobility and independence due to weight gain and are suffering from severe health issues. Following are several key things to note about the bariatric surgery New York doctors are offering.

Many people are able to reach their final target weights within a very short period of time. These procedures can reduce the stomach size or they may be used to alter the way in which the digestive tract is arranged and functions. Following your treatment, you will find that just two ounces of food or liquid make you feel full. If you eat or drink beyond this point, sickness can occur. These procedures make it a challenge to eat beyond your needs.

You should know that it is necessary to radically change your current eating habits in order to account for your smaller stomach size or the structural changes that have been made to your overall digestive tract. This often requires a lot of determination and work for people who are used to overeating. It will be necessary to find new strategies for comforting yourself during difficult times and new hobbies to enhance your life.

If people are not able to implement the right lifestyle changes after their procedures, they may deal with major health issues. People can develop scar tissue around their gastric sleeves. This is also a problem that occurs with stomach stapling. As such, surgeons are committed to ensuring that prospective patient are really ready to do the necessary work even before their procedures are performed.

You may have had a failed procedure in the past and want to try this type of surgery again, and this will require a special consultation and exam with the surgeon. Your provider will look for signs of scar tissue and other lasting complications. You will also need to work extra hard to show that you are prepared to commit fully to the program that has been outlined by your provider for promoting lasting success.

Your surgeon will establish a target weight that you will need to reach before you can have your treatment performed. This will involve going on a very limited diet. Most pre-surgery diets have a 1200 calorie limit and are focused on the consumption of high-protein, low-sugar foods.

Meeting with a therapist is often a required part of thee treatments. Your surgeon will want you to learn more about the emotional triggers that have been causing you to eat more than your body actually needs. Learning more about these triggers and finding healthy ways to manage them is important.

You can gain many important advantages from this type of treatment. As your body moves closer to its ideal weight, you will start enjoying a fuller and higher quality life. If you have had problems with infertility before, your reproductive system will likely improve. Because you will need time to recover, heal and adapt, you may be advised to wait several years before attempting to start a family.
